How to Access Mental Health Services in Sioux Falls
Accessing mental health services can seem overwhelming at first, but with a clear plan, it becomes manageable. Here’s how you can begin your journey towards better mental health.
Step 1: Identify Your Needs
Understanding your specific mental health needs is the first step. This involves recognizing symptoms such as persistent sadness, anxiety, irritability, or any other feelings that interfere with your daily life. Keep a diary of your feelings, noting when they occur and what might trigger them.
Step 2: Research Local Services
Sioux Falls offers a range of mental health services, including counseling, psychiatric care, and support groups. To find services that suit your needs, consider the following:
- Visit local health clinics or hospitals: Places like Avera Mental Health Center offer comprehensive services.
- Check online directories: Websites like Psychology Today or the local government’s health resources can provide detailed information.
- Ask for recommendations: Friends, family, or primary care doctors can suggest reliable mental health professionals.
Step 3: Contact and Schedule an Appointment
Once you’ve identified a provider or service, the next step is to call and schedule an appointment. Be prepared to provide some initial information about your mental health history.
Here’s what to expect during your first visit:
- A comprehensive intake assessment: The mental health professional will discuss your symptoms, concerns, and medical history.
- Developing a treatment plan: Based on your assessment, a personalized plan will be created to address your specific needs.
Step 4: Follow Through with Treatment
Consistency is key in mental health treatment. Attend all scheduled sessions, take prescribed medications as directed, and communicate openly with your healthcare provider about any changes in your condition.
Tips for Enhancing Mental Health in Sioux Falls
In addition to professional care, there are several self-care strategies you can incorporate into your daily routine to support mental health. Here are some practical tips:
1. Stay Active: Regular physical activity can significantly improve mood and reduce anxiety. Consider joining a local gym, taking walking or running groups, or participating in community sports.
2. Eat Well: Nutrition plays a critical role in mental health. Incorporate a bal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and whole grains. Avoid excessive caffeine and sugar, which can affect your mood.
3. Practice Mindfulness: Mindfulness and meditation can help manage stress and improve emotional regulation. Look for local meditation classes or online resources.
4. Connect with Others: Social connections are vital for mental well-being. Join community groups, volunteer, or participate in local events to build a supportive social network.
5. Limit Screen Time: Excessive screen time, especially on social media, can negatively impact mental health. Set boundaries on your screen time and use technology mindfully.
FAQs About Mental Health Services in Sioux Falls
How can I find a good therapist in Sioux Falls?
Finding the right therapist involves a bit of research and trial. Here’s a step-by-step approach:
- Use online directories: Websites like Psychology Today or the Psychology Association often list qualified therapists.
- Check local health clinics: Avera Mental Health Center and other local hospitals provide directories of their mental health professionals.
- Ask for referrals: Your primary care doctor, friends, or family can provide recommendations.
- Schedule consultations: If possible, meet briefly with potential therapists to discuss your needs and see if you feel comfortable.
What if I can’t afford mental health services?
Accessing affordable mental health care is a common concern. Here are some solutions:
- Community health centers: Many local clinics offer services on a sliding scale based on income.
- Sliding scale services: Some private practices provide mental health services at reduced rates for those with limited financial resources.
- Insurance coverage: Verify your health insurance coverage for mental health services. Many plans include mental health care benefits.
- Grants and scholarships: Look for local or national organizations that offer grants or scholarships for mental health care.
How do I know if I need medication for my mental health?
Deciding on medication should always be a joint decision with a healthcare professional. Here’s how to determine if medication might be necessary:
- Persistent symptoms: If you experience severe symptoms like intense depression, anxiety, or mood swings that last for weeks or months despite other interventions.
- Impact on daily life: If mental health issues are significantly affecting your ability to work, study, or maintain relationships.
- Professional assessment: A mental health professional will conduct a thorough assessment to determine the best course of treatment.
Maintaining Long-Term Mental Health in Sioux Falls
Long-term mental health requires ongoing effort and commitment. Here are some advanced strategies to maintain your mental well-being:
1. Develop a Routine: A consistent daily routine can provide stability and reduce stress. Include time for work, exercise, leisure, and rest.
2. Engage in Continuous Learning: Learning new skills or hobbies can provide a sense of accomplishment and keep your mind engaged. Consider enrolling in classes or online courses.
3. Stay Informed: Keeping up-to-date with mental health research can provide new insights and strategies for self-care. Read books, attend workshops, or follow reputable mental health blogs.
4. Regular Check-Ins: Schedule regular appointments with your mental health professional to monitor your progress and make adjustments to your treatment plan as needed.
5. Community Involvement: Deepening your involvement in community activities can provide additional support and reduce feelings of isolation. Volunteer work, local groups, and clubs are excellent opportunities for engagement.
